The City must comply with all applicable Federal, State, and local laws, <br /> ordinances, and regulations. <br /> 2. Nondiscrimination. It is the policy of the Federal Highway <br /> Administration and the State-of Minnesota that no person in the United <br /> States will, on the grounds of race, color, or national origin, be.excluded <br /> ''from particip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be subjected to <br /> discrimination under any program or activity receiving Federal financial <br /> assistance '(42 U.S.C. 2000d). Through expansion of the mandate for <br /> nondiscrimination in Title VI and through parallel legislation, the <br /> prescribed bases of discrimination include race, color, sex, national origin, <br /> age, and disability. In addition, the Title VI program has been extended to <br /> cover all programs, activities and services of an entity receiving Federal <br /> financial assistance, whether such programs and activities are Federally <br /> assisted or not. Even in .the absence of prior discriminatory practice or <br /> usage, a recipient in administering a program or activity to which this part <br /> applies, is expected to take affirmative action to assure that no person is <br /> excluded from participation in, or is denied the benefits of, the program or <br /> activity on the grounds of race, color, national origin, sex, age, or <br /> disability. It is the responsibility of the City to carry out the above <br /> requirements. <br /> 3. Workers' Compensation.
